A brand-new Employment Hub on the Headland has been officially opened, providing residents with a welcoming, accessible space to gain support, build skills and explore new job opportunities.
The new facility, located inside of the Headland Library, forms part of Hartlepool Borough Council’s wider commitment to helping people of all ages into work, training, apprenticeships and volunteering. The Hub offers impartial information, advice and guidance from the Council’s specialist Jobs and Skills team, supporting residents with everything from job searching and CV writing to interview preparation, digital access and career planning.
Working in partnership with local employers, training providers and community organisations, the Hub provides tailored one‑to‑one support and connects people with a broad range of learning, skills and employment opportunities across Hartlepool and the wider Tees Valley.

The new Employment Hub forms part of the wider network of Employment Hubs across the town, ensuring residents can access employment and skills support within their own neighbourhood. The Jobs & Skills team already supports over 1,000 people in Hartlepool each year, helping them gain new skills, secure work and move closer to their career goals.
The Headland Employment Hub is open weekdays from 9am-12noon and then 12:30pm-4:30pm except Tuesday when it open from 10am-12:30pm and then 1pm-6pm. Further details about the range of support available through the Council’s Employment Hubs can be found at hartlepooljobsandskills.com.
